SparkPlugService
_ WARNING! DO NOT check for spark with spark
plug removed. DO NOT crank engine with spark
plug removed.
Check the spark plug yearly or every 100 operating hours. To
ensure proper engine operation, the spark plug must be properly
gapped and free of deposits.
1. Remove the spark plug boot.
2. Clean the area around the spark plug.
3. Use a spark plug wrench to remove the plug.
i_i WARNING! If the engine has been running, the
muffler, engine head and spark plug will be very hot.
Be careful not to touch any of these components
until they have cooled.
4. Visually inspect the spark plug. Discard the spark plug
if there is apparent wear, or if the insulator is cracked or
chipped. Replace the plug if the electrodes are pitted,
burned or fouled with deposits.
5. Clean the spark plug with a wire brush if it is to be reused.
6. Measure the plug gap with a feeler gauge. Correct as
necessary by bending side electrode. See Fig. 6-4. The gap
should be set to 0.030 in. (0.76mm).
AirFilter
NOTE: Not all engines have air filters, such as engines used for
snow throwers. Service the air filter if one is present.
Paper filters cannot be cleaned and must be replaced once a year
or every 100 operating hours; more often if used in extremely
dusty conditions.
__i WARNING! Never use gasoline or low flash point
solvents for cleaning the air cleaner element. A fire
or explosion could result.
NOTE: Never run the engines that have air filters without them.
Rapid engine wear can result.
1. Press the tab on the air filter cover and lift the cover, or
un-thread the thumbscrews, depending on the model of
engine you have. See Fig. 6-5.
2. Replace paper element when dirty or damaged. Clean
foam element or replace when damaged.

Check that the spark plug washer is in good condition
Thread the spark plug in by hand to prevent cross-
threading.
After the spark plug is seated, tighten with a spark plug
wrench to compress the washer.
NOTE:When installing a new spark plug, tighten 1/2turn
after the spark plug seats to compress the washer. When
reinstalling a used spark plug, tighten 1/8-1/4turn after the
spark plug seatsto compress the washer.
NOTE:The spark plug must be securely tightened. An
improperly tightened spark plug can become very hot and
may damage the engine.

To clean foam element, separate it from the paper element
and wash in liquid detergent and water. Allow to dry
thoroughly before using. Do not oil the foam element.
Adjustments
DO NOT make any engine adjustments. Factory settings are
satisfactory for most conditions. If adjustments are needed,
contact your Authorized MTD Servicing Dealer.
Carburetor
If you think you carburetor needs adjusting, see your nearest
Authorized MTD Servicing Dealer. Engine performance should
NOT be affected at altitudes up to 7,000 feet (2,134 meters). For
operation at higher elevations, contact your Authorized MTD
Servicing Dealer
